Six blood pressure readings are 115, 120, 123, 121, 121, and 112 mm Hg. What is the average (mean) value?

Answers

Answer:

118.666666667 mmHg

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the average/mean of a set of values, you add all the values together, then divide them by the amount of values in the set.

115+120+123+121+121+112 = 712

Since there is 6 values, you divide this by 6.

712÷6 = 118.666666667 mmHg

Triangle ABC is similar to triangle QRS by the AA Similarity Postulate.Also, m∠A = 45° and m∠S = 75°.

What is m∠B?

_________ °

Answers

Answer:

Measure of ∠B is 60°    

Step-by-step explanation:

Given triangle ABC is similar to triangle QRS.

m∠A = 45° and m∠S = 75°

we have to find the measure of ∠B.

As triangles are similar then corresponding angles are congruent.

⇒ ∠A≅∠Q, ∠B≅∠R, ∠C≅∠S

hence, m∠C=m∠S=75°

By angle sum property

m∠A+m∠B+m∠C=180°

⇒ 45°+m∠B+75°=180°

⇒ m∠B+120°=180°

⇒ m∠B=60°

hence, measure of ∠B is 60°

What is a simple formula to solve a math sequence? Or a couple formulas if possible? Thanks!

Answers

2 normal types of sequences:

1. arythmetic sequences: each term is the same distance to the next term, example, 2,4,6,8, distance is 2

2. geometric sequences: the ratio of consecutive terms is the same, example: 2,4,8,16, ratio is 4:2=2:1, 2/1=2


the nth term is denoted by a_(n)
the first term is represented by a_(1)

for arythmetic sequences, the nth tem is
a_(n)=a_(1)(n-1)d where d=distance between each term

for geometric sequences the nth term is
[tex] a_{n}=a_{1}r^{n-1} where r=ratio betwen consecutive terms

An amusement park has 11 roller coasters. In how many ways can you choose 4 of the roller coasters to ride during your visit to the park?

Answers

4!=4*3*2*1=24
11!=11*10*9*8*7*6*5*4*3*2*1=39916800
7!=7*6*5*4*3*2*1=5040
n choose k
how many ways are there to choose k rollercoasters from n choices?

\left(\begin{array}{ccc}n\nk\end{array}\right)=(n!)/(k!(n-k)!)

\left(\begin{array}{ccc}11\n4\end{array}\right)=(11!)/(4!(11-4)!)=(39916800)/(24(7)!)=(39916800)/(24(5040))=(39916800)/(120960)=330



330 ways
